SubjectRe: [PATCH -tip v2 3/3] [BUGFIX] kprobes: Prohibit probing on func_ptr_is_kernel_text
On Fri, 01 Nov 2013 11:25:37 +0000
Masami Hiramatsu <masami.hiramatsu.pt@hitachi.com> wrote:

> Prohibit probing on func_ptr_is_kernel_text().
> Since the func_ptr_is_kernel_text() is called from
> notifier_call_chain() which is called from int3 handler,
> probing it may cause double int3 fault and kernel will
> reboot.
>
> This happenes when the kernel built with CONFIG_DEBUG_NOTIFIERS=y.

Reviewed-by: Steven Rostedt <rostedt@goodmis.org>
